Williams scoops fourth Challenge Tour title of 2022

Scott Williams (Kais Bodensieck/PDC)

Scott Williams clinched his fourth Winmau Challenge Tour title of 2022 with victory at Event 20 in Leicester on Sunday.

Williams extended his lead at the top of the Challenge Tour Order of Merit with a 5-2 win over Thibault Tricole in the fifth and final event of the weekend at the Morningside Arena.

The 32-year-old won three of the first six events in 2022, and he returned to winning ways in emphatic style to establish a £3,700 lead over Robert Owen in the overall standings.

Williams relinquished just four legs in his opening three matches - including a comprehensive 5-1 win over Event 19 winner Christian Kist – before recovering from 3-1 down to deny Raymond Marshall in a last-leg decider in round four.

Williams, a winner at Players Championship 17 in June, then posted a ton-plus average to whitewash John Cook, and resounding wins over Kai Fan Leung and Dan Read saw him progress to Sunday’s showpiece.

Tricole converted classy 126 and 96 checkouts to move into a 2-0 lead in the final, but the Englishman responded by winning the next five legs without reply to clinch the £2,000 top prize.

Earlier in the day, Tricole produced a series of impressive displays to become the first ever Frenchman to feature in a Challenge Tour final, kicking off his campaign with a 5-1 win over Event 18 runner-up Patrick Peters.

He also dumped out Paul Hogan, David Pallett and Owen Roelofs to claim the £1,000 runner-up prize, which catapults him up to 17th on the Challenge Tour Order of Merit.

Elsewhere, Lukas Wenig, who landed a nine-darter in Event 17 on Friday, produced the performance of the day, averaging 104.38 in his opening round whitewash of Derek Grazier.

The Winmau Challenge Tour returns from October 15-16, with Events 21-24 taking place at the Morningside Arena.

The top two players from the final 2022 Challenge Tour Order of Merit will secure a PDC Tour Card for 2023/24 and a place in the 2022/23 Cazoo World Darts Championship.

The Challenge Tour Order of Merit winner will also secure a spot at November’s Cazoo Grand Slam of Darts in Wolverhampton.

2022 Winmau Challenge Tour
Sunday September 18, Event 20
Morningside Arena, Leicester
Quarter-Finals

Dan Read 5-2 Darryl Pilgrim
Scott Williams 5-2 Kai Fan Leung
Owen Roelofs 5-2 Danny Lauby
Thibault Tricole 5-3 David Pallett

Semi-Finals
Scott Williams 5-1 Dan Read
Thibault Tricole 5-2 Owen Roelofs

Final
Scott Williams 5-2 Thibault Tricole
